Patios do not require lots of maintenance. They will only need occasional cleaning to make sure that the material keeps its original appearance. It's always best to clean your patio with a pressure washer and occasionally tap each slab or brick just to check the sand underneath hasn't washed away.
Harleston
Redenhall with Harleston is a civil parish in the South Norfolk district of the English county of Norfolk, making up the town of Harleston and the adjoining town of Redenhall. It covers an area of 13.73 km2 (5.30 sq mi), and also had a population of 4,058 in 1,841 homes at the 2001 census, the population enhancing to 4,640 at the 2011 census. Several Georgian homes as well as a lot earlier buildings, with Georgian frontages, line the streets of Harleston. Although there is no document of an imperial charter, Harleston has been a market community considering that at least 1369 as well as still holds a Wednesday market.
